Reasearch Title: The Potential of using Public Private Partnerships to procure public ICT projects

I am a student currently reading for an M.B.A. in E-Business at the University of Malta, and as part of my thesis I am conducting a survey on the potential of awarding contracts under public private partnerships instead of traditional customer-supplier contracts, to realize public ICT projects.

Purpose: To investigate the views of the IT private sector in Malta regarding Public Private Partnerships (PPP) as a procurement model for government ICT projects. Also to study the private sector willingness and concerns to embark on projects under the PPP programme instead of using conventional procurement methods when supplying public ICT projects.

In this research the concept of Public Private Partnerships is characterized by:
- long term relationship between public and private sector organisations
- the private sector cooperates in decision making
- the private sector is encouraged to bring forward experiences and ideas to how best provide a public good or service
- the relationship involves a negotiated allocation of risks between the private and the public sector
